Chinese court sentences Uyghur scholar to life in prison

Chinese court sentences Uyghur scholar to life in prison

TOKYO, Japan - Photo taken in June 2010 shows Uyghur scholar Ilham Tohti. On Sept. 23, 2014, the Urumqi People's Intermediate Court in the western China region of Xinjiang sentenced Tohti to life in prison for separatism, an unusually severe conclusion to a case that has drawn condemnation from around the world. The sentence, which includes the seizure of all of Tohti's assets, is the harshest punishment handed down to a Chinese activist in the recent past.

Chinese man gets life over tainted dumplings

Chinese man gets life over tainted dumplings

SHIJIAZHUANG, China - A Jan. 19, 2014, photo shows the site where a food plant used to be in Shijiazhuang, the capital of North China's Hebei Province. Lu Yueting, a 39-year-old former temporary worker at the plant was sentenced Jan. 20 by the Shijiazhuang Intermediate People's Court to life in prison after he admitted to poisoning frozen "gyoza" dumplings that made 14 people in Japan and China ill six years ago.
